Podcast Overview
<p>Hi this is Kate Davis I’m a comic and keynote Speaker, and thanks for checking out my Podcast Humor in the C-Suite where I interview leaders, executives and business owners on how they use humor and levity to create an extraordinary work culture. I want to ask the questions that we all want answers to like… Does humor help us or harm us at work? Does humor change our perception of a problem? And how do our leaders use humor to inspire curiosity, success and innovation. I want to be a fly in their chardonnay, I mean a fly on their wall. Honestly, I’m as curious as you are…So join me and a guest every week for Humor in the C-Suite</p>

Coding with Humor: Leadership Lessons from Tech CEO Jeroen Derwort
What does it look like when a shy kid who hated networking accidentally builds a game with 200 million players, survives corporate lawsuits, charms tax inspectors into forgetting why they came, and learns to lead by doing? That's Jeroen Derwort's story. In this episode of Humor in the C Suite, Kate Davis sits down with the former CEO of Gamebasics to explore how humor, humility, and a very healthy relationship with imperfection built one of the most unlikely success stories in gaming history ...

The Flight of Authenticity: How Lisa Pagotto Leads with Humor in the World's Most Extreme Destinations
What does leadership look like when your boardroom is a remote jungle and your team is scattered across time zones navigating geopolitical complexity? For Lisa Pagotto, founder of Crooked Compass, it looks like authenticity, resilience, and a finely tuned sense of humor. Work Happy: Why Humor is the Gateway to Mental Health at Work with Keynote Speaker Greg Kettner
What if one joke — sent on a Friday morning — could remind someone they matter? What if three words from a stage could stop someone from ending their life? Greg Kettner has seen both happen. In this episode of Humor in the C Suite, Kate Davis sits down with her old comedy circuit friend turned keynote speaker to explore the unexpected intersection of humor and mental health — and why the leaders who get this right are the ones their teams never forget.
